Use Intel's CPU Manager for Kubernetes (CMK)
Use the CMK user manual to run a workload via CMK.
See https://github.com/intel/CPU-Manager-for-Kubernetes/blob/master/docs/user.md#pod-configuration-on-the-clusters-with-cmk-mutating-webhook-kubernetes-v190 for detailed instructions.
The basic workflow is to:
Request the number of exclusive cores you want as:
cmk.intel.com/exclusive-cores
Run your workload as:
/opt/bin/cmk isolate --pool=exclusive <workload>
